SHRIMP AND VEGETABLE YELLOW CURRY
Provided by Giada De Laurentiis
Time 40m
Yield 4 servings
Number Of Ingredients 17
Steps:
- In a large saucepan, bring the coconut milk and curry paste to a boil over medium-high heat, whisking constantly until smooth, about 2 minutes. Add the chicken broth, carrot, red bell pepper, onion, baby corn, basil, chile, lime leaves and fish sauce. Bring the mixture to a simmer over medium-low heat. Cover the pan and cook until the vegetables are tender, about 20 minutes.
- Pour the oil into a large wide saucepan. Attach a deep-fry thermometer to the side of the saucepan and heat the oil to 350 degrees F. Add half of the noodles and fry until crisp, about 20 seconds. Drain on paper towels and set aside.
- Remove the lid from the curry and add the shrimp, snap peas and the remaining noodles. Simmer, uncovered, until the shrimp is cooked through, 5 to 7 minutes. Remove the lime leaves and basil sprigs and discard.
- Ladle the curry into bowls. Garnish with the fried noodles, cilantro and peanuts.
SHRIMP CURRY WITH COCONUT MILK AND SUGAR SNAP PEAS
This is delicious and easy enough for me to do after work when I get a craving for it. Be sure to serve with plenty of steamed rice to soak up the sauce. Recipe from Sam Choy's Sampler.
Provided by Hey Jude
Categories Lunch/Snacks
Time 50m
Yield 6 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 14
Steps:
- In a heavy skillet, heat 2 tablespoons of the butter and olive oil, and saute onion and curry powder until onion is translucent.
- Add shrimp, sugar, ginger, salt and pepper.
- Saute 3-4 minutes, then remove to a plate.
- In the skillet, melt remaining 4 tablespoons butter, stir in flour and cook 5 minutes.
- Slowly add cream, chicken stock and coconut milk, stirring constantly until mixture is smooth and thick.
- Return shrimp to pan, along with snap peas; heat through.
- Serve with steamed rice.
